**Q: My plugin's exports aren't appearing in the Ferrowave partner SFTP drop. Why?**

Files land in the drop only after nightly validation passes. Rejected files go to the `/quarantine` folder with a reason code. Check there first. Uploads larger than 2GB must be split. If a validated file is still missing after 24 hours, contact the partner integrations desk at the address below.

escalation mailbox, hadug-bajog: sormir@norvalabs.internal

**Alert: Transcode queue backing up on Fernhollow farm**

Heads up — this fires when the Fernhollow transcoding farm's pending-job count stays above threshold for 15 minutes. Usually it's a stuck worker hogging a GPU slot, sometimes it's a flood of 4K uploads after a big creator event. First move: check worker health and requeue anything in a zombie state. Don't restart the whole farm unless at least three nodes are wedged. Triage steps and escalation order live on this page.

operations page: https://jira.lumicsys.internal/browse/browse/display/projects

FAQ: Where is the evacuation-chair store and who can open it?

The evacuation-chair store at Merrivale Point is beside Stairwell D on each floor. Only facilities desk staff and trained wardens may open it, and every opening must be logged in the Corven register. Chairs are inspected quarterly by Aldstone Safety. The cupboard keypad accepts the access code below.

staff pass of kawip-hawef = bdg-QLP-2